Transaction 5b21bcb56f89c3bd90a72e625a921e9b73d717578d2f29e630a510b0f62ad61e
1 Input
2 Outputs
- 5b21bcb56f89c3bd90a72e625a921e9b73d717578d2f29e630a510b0f62ad61e:0
- 5b21bcb56f89c3bd90a72e625a921e9b73d717578d2f29e630a510b0f62ad61e:1
value 3589380
address 1DMM5mVFLdDKjrPsrRNENhVdJiG1cBRLKV
value 19719817
address 3PUuiYu5cFMsagkffArrKZzQFtWdHttU3x